Anthology of Medieval Music

Anthology of Medieval Music

ISBN: , SKU: , AUTHOR: Hoppin, Richard H., PUBLISHER: W. W. Norton & Company, Most of the seventy-one works have been freshly transcribed, and all have been newly engraved for this collection. In choosing the works for inclusion in this collection, many of which have been available in a modern edition, Professor Hoppin ranged widely throughout the gamut of medieval music forms. For example, all the movements for the Solemn Mass of Easter Day are offered along with typical troubadour and trouvere works. Examples of sequence, clausula, organum, and conductus are presented together with Latin and English love songs, motets, rondeaux, and ballate. The result is a history of medieval music in itself. there ar no snippets or frustrating samples, but only complete works or-at least-integral movements of larger works. All the characteristic styles of the period are represented, and text translations accompany each work.

Michael Hakimi

Michael Hakimi

ISBN: , SKU: , AUTHOR: Hakimi, Michael / Szymczyk, Adam / Dziewior, Yilmaz, PUBLISHER: Hatje Cantz Publishers, The murals, computer images, paper works, drawings and objects of Berlin-based Michael Hakimi are combined in site-specific installations to form intricate networks of meaning. Hakimi expands the function of his formally reduced, two-dimensional images by means of his interventions, emphasizing the semantic divide between object and sign. The artist examines the narrative potential of symbols and basic geometric shapes through the collagelike interaction of his works with readymades of the simplest materials. His installation "Large Oven" (), for example, realized for the Kunstverein Hamburg, and the spatial project "Roof" (), produced for the Kunsthalle Basel, both of which are comprehensively documented for the first time in the present publication, create walk-in scenarios reflecting social, political and urban realities. Beyond these works, this retrospective monograph presents all of Hakimi's work since .

A Handbook on Hanging

A Handbook on Hanging

ISBN: , SKU: , AUTHOR: Duff, Charles / Hitchens, Christopher, PUBLISHER: New York Review of Books, "A Handbook on Hanging" is a Swiftian tribute to that unappreciated mainstay of civilization: the hangman. With barbed insouciance, Charles Duff writes not only of hanging but of electrocution, decapitations, and gassings; of innocent men executed and of executions botched; of the bloodlust of mobs and the shabby excuses of the great. This coruscating and, in contemporary America, very relevant polemic makes clear that whatever else capital punishment may be said to be--justice, vengeance, a deterrent--it is certainly killing.
